The basic principle of GPS positioning is to determine the position of the point to be measured by using the method of space distance resection based on the instantaneous position of the high-speed moving satellite as the known starting data. Assuming that the GPS receiver is placed at the point to be measured on the ground at time t, the time △ t when the GPS signal arrives at the receiver can be measured. In addition to the satellite ephemeris and other data received by the receiver, the following four equations can be determined:
In the above four equations, the coordinates x, y, z and Vto of the point to be measured are unknown parameters, where di=c △ ti (i=1,2,3,4).
Di (i=1, 2, 3, 4) is the distance from satellite 1, satellite 2, satellite 3, and satellite 4 to the receiver.
△ ti (i=1, 2, 3, 4) is the time that the signal of satellite 1, satellite 2, satellite 3, and satellite 4 arrives at the receiver.
C is the propagation speed of GPS signal (i.e. the speed of light).
The meanings of each parameter in the four equations are as follows:
x. Y, z are the space rectangular coordinates of the coordinates of the point to be measured.
Xi, yi, zi (i=1, 2, 3, 4) are respectively the space rectangular coordinates of satellite 1, satellite 2, satellite 3, and satellite 4 at time t,
It can be obtained from satellite navigation messages.
Vti (i=1, 2, 3, 4) is the clock difference of satellite clocks of satellite 1, satellite 2, satellite 3, and satellite 4 respectively, which is provided by satellite ephemeris.
Vto is the clock error of the receiver.
The coordinates x, y, z of the point to be measured and the clock difference Vto of the receiver can be calculated from the above four equations.
